hooksendrecvwsasendwsarecv封包工具源码:网络数据监控的利器
随着网络技术的飞速发展,对于网络数据包的监控和分析成为了网络安全和软件开发中的重要环节。今天,我们将为大家介绍一款开源的封包工具源码——hooksendrecvwsasendwsarecv,它能够帮助开发者轻松实现对网络数据包的拦截与分析。
项目介绍
hooksendrecvwsasendwsarecv是一款功能强大的封包工具源码,它提供了命令行操作界面,能够通过远程线程注入技术,将特定代码注入到目标进程中。成功注入后,该工具可以hook住send、recv、wsasend、wsarecv等发包函数,实现对封包数据的拦截。
项目技术分析
技术架构
该工具的核心技术包括:
- 远程线程注入:通过创建远程线程的方式,将自定义的代码注入到目标进程中,从而实现对进程行为的监控和控制。
- 封包拦截:hook住关键的发包函数,如send、recv、wsasend、wsarecv,以实现对数据包的拦截和分析。
开发环境
- 主程序:采用MFC(Microsoft Foundation Classes)编写,为开发者提供了丰富的用户界面和操作体验。
- 动态链接库:基于VC WIN32项目,为工具提供了底层的功能支持。
项目及技术应用场景
网络安全
在网络安全的领域,hooksendrecvwsasendwsarecv可以帮助安全专家分析潜在的攻击行为,及时发现并阻止恶意数据包的传输。
软件开发
软件开发者可以利用此工具进行网络通信协议的分析,优化网络性能,或是在开发过程中调试网络相关的bug。
教育和研究
教育机构和研究人员可以通过此工具学习和研究网络通信的底层原理,加深对网络协议的理解。
项目特点
- 命令行操作:提供简洁易用的命令行界面,方便用户快速上手和操作。
- 远程线程注入技术:采用高效的远程线程注入技术,保证工具的稳定性和效率。
- 多函数hook:支持hook多种发包函数,实现对不同类型数据包的拦截。
- 安全合规:工具设计时考虑了安全性,用户需在合法范围内使用,避免非法用途。
在使用此工具时,请确保遵循相关法律法规,不要用于非法目的。如在使用过程中遇到问题,建议通过技术论坛或专业社区寻求解决方案。
总之,hooksendrecvwsasendwsarecv封包工具源码为网络数据监控和分析提供了一个有效的解决方案,无论是网络安全专家、软件开发者,还是教育研究人员,都可以从中受益。开源的精神让这样的工具得以共享,让我们共同探索网络世界的奥秘。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考